Oak Brook, IL – Stolen Vehicle from Oak Brook Recovered in Indiana; New York Area Men Arrested on I-65

Oak Brook, IL – An interstate investigation has led to the arrest of three men from the New York area following the recovery of a stolen vehicle from Oak Brook, Illinois. 

According to the Indiana State Police-Lafayette District’s Facebook update, the incident occurred around 11 PM Thursday night on Interstate 65, near the 158-mile marker, when a Trooper initiated a traffic stop late in the evening, where he noted the smell of marijuana emanating from the vehicle. A subsequent search resulted in the discovery of suspected marijuana and property reported as stolen.

The men were detained and have been transported to Clinton County Jail, with charges pending as the investigation continues. The vehicle and other items recovered have been turned over to the Oak Brook Illinois Police Department, who are conducting a further probe into the incident.
